I found one at a great price, but I am more worried about performance. Anyone have any experience with them?
 
Not sure what you mean by "performance"? Any pump gun, (as opposed to a recoil or gas operated gun) using the same shells, with the same length bbl will have virtually the same performance - speed of the load, etc.

If you are referring to pattern and spread, that is more a function of the choke in the individual barrel.

I have a Weatherby SA-8 Upland Deluxe 20ga. This is a great quail gun. It's light, shoulders well, has nicely figured walnut and is reliable. Have even shot clays with it without a glitch. I don't have experience with the PA(pump) version but I would think it's just as well made and reliable.
